Bird mite
Ornithonyssus sylviarum / Dermanyssus gallinae
- Order & Family
- Order: Mesostigmata; Family: Macronyssidae / Dermanyssidae
- Size
- 0.5 mm to 1 mm (barely visible to the naked eye)
Natural Habitat
Nests of wild or domestic birds, often migrating into homes when birds leave the nest
Diet & Feeding
Blood from avian hosts; will opportunistically bite humans if birds are unavailable
Behavior Patterns
Active primarily at night; they are extremely mobile and can quickly infest structures near bird nesting sites
Risks & Benefits
Cause intense itching, skin irritation, and dermatitis in humans; do not transmit diseases to humans but are significant household pests
